David Mencin is a scholar working on Geophysics, Artificial Intelligence and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, David Mencin has authored 31 papers receiving a total of 443 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Geophysics, 9 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 6 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in David Mencin’s work include earthquake and tectonic studies (16 papers), Earthquake Detection and Analysis (10 papers) and Seismic Waves and Analysis (7 papers). David Mencin is often cited by papers focused on earthquake and tectonic studies (16 papers), Earthquake Detection and Analysis (10 papers) and Seismic Waves and Analysis (7 papers). David Mencin collaborates with scholars based in United States, Puerto Rico and Luxembourg. David Mencin's co-authors include Roger Bilham, Rebecca Bendick, K. M. Hodgkinson, Roland Bürgmann, G. S. Mattioli, Brent Henderson, John Langbein, A. A. Borsa, Shaul Hurwitz and Olivier Francis and has published in prestigious journals such as Earth and Planetary Science Letters, Geophysical Research Letters and Nature Geoscience.
